Offshore wave potential of the Mediterranean sea
Authors
F. Karathanasi Soukissian, T. Sifnioti, D.
Publication date
1 January 2015
Publisher
Abstract
Among the most promising ocean renewable energy sources, offshore wave energy stands out. In Europe, intensive research and development of offshore wave energy technologies has been carried out with the aim of contributing to the growing demand for clean energy. In order to assess the feasibility of the development of a wave energy device in a specific region, the reliable estimation of the local wave energy potential is crucial. In this work, the offshore wave energy potential for the Mediterranean Sea is presented in an annual and seasonal basis. The assessment is based on wave data from numerical wave simulation models obtained by ECMWF. These hindcast data are in the form of time series and cover a 35-year period (1979 – 2013). In addition, in the same time scales the mean wave direction is estimated, a variable that is often omitted from similar analyses. © 2015, European Association for the Development of Renewable Energy, Environment and Power Quality (EA4EPQ).
